Living Well with a Chronic Condition
This workshop is appropriate for family, friends and caregivers who seek problem-solving skills related to successful living with a chronic disease. This six-week workshop provides tools that will help you:
· Manage symptoms, including pain and fatigue
· Make good nutrition and exercise choices
· Understand new treatment options
· Communicate effectively with your doctor and family about your health

Moving Well. Living Well.
This six-week, low impact exercise program focuses on improving balance, mobility, strength and endurance.  The program’s movements were developed to address the pain, fatigue and decreases in strength that often accompany chronic diseases and health concerns. While every person is unique, many people who participate in the program experience decreased pain, improved overall health, increased flexibility, increased energy, improved sleep and increased bone density.

Tobacco Cessation Services
Tobacco dependency is a chronic condition. St. Luke's provides counseling and behavioral support to help individuals wanting to quit tobacco. With so many medication options available, we will help you determine the treatment that is best for you. We offer group programs as well as one-on-one support. 

St. Luke's group program, Freedom From Smoking®, will help you overcome your tobacco addiction while having the support of others. This seven week class will teach you about medicines to help you quit smoking, lifestyle changes to make quitting easier, managing stress, avoiding weight gain, and developing a new self-image to stay smoke-free for good!
